What is the MCAA?
The Mechanical Contractors Association of America is a vibrant, national trade association representing mechanical contractors who install heating, ventilating, air conditioning (HVAC), plumbing, piping, and refrigeration systems in commercial, industrial, and institutional buildings. MCAA provides its members with high-quality educational materials, industry updates, and networking opportunities.
